It is a randomized crossover study, meaning participants will try different diets in a random order.","completed","Healthy Diets with Plant Oils for Heart and Metabolic Health","This study is looking at how different healthy diets, specifically those containing cottonseed oil compared to other plant oils, affect your heart and metabolic health. Researchers want to see if a healthy diet with cottonseed oil improves your LDL-cholesterol (often called \"bad\" cholesterol) more than diets with other plant oils. You might be able to join if you are between 25 and 60 years old, have LDL-cholesterol between 100 and 190 mg\u002FdL, and a BMI between 25 and 40 kg\u002Fm2.
